Hello - 

I have a VI that graphs data from 36 thermocouple channels.

Data saved as CSV file.

I like to take a screen capture at the end of each run but forgot to do one.

Can I recall the data into LabView to get my screen capture after the fact?

 

Thanks!

Just read the appropriate csv file. Read from Speadsheet or Read From Measurement File. Whatever complimentary function you used to write the data.
